Types of Replacement Closet Doors
When it pertains to changing bifold closet doors, there are several choices to think about. Some popular options include:
- Sliding closet doors: These doors slide along a track, offering easy access to the closet contents. They're ideal for small spaces and can be set up with a soft-close mechanism for added benefit.
- Hinged closet doors: These doors are connected to the frame with hinges and can be set up as a single door or as a pair. They use a more standard look and can be embellished with decorative hardware.
- Accordion closet doors: These doors fold like an accordion when opened, offering a space-saving service for larger closet openings.
- Pocket closet doors: These doors slide into a pocket in the wall when opened, creating a streamlined, minimalist appearance.
Products and Finishes
Replacement closet doors are offered in a large range of products and surfaces, including:
- Wood: Solid wood, engineered wood, and wood veneer are popular choices for closet doors.
- MDF: Medium-density fiber board (MDF) is a cost-effective alternative to wood and can be completed to match any decor.
- Glass: Glass closet doors can include a touch of sophistication to a space and provide a clear view of the closet contents.
- Vinyl: Vinyl closet doors are long lasting, low-maintenance, and can simulate the look of wood or other materials.
Step-by-Step Replacement Guide
Changing troubleshooting bifold doors closet doors is a reasonably uncomplicated process that can be finished with basic tools and DIY abilities. Here's a detailed guide:
- Measure the opening: Measure the width and height of the closet opening to determine the size of the replacement doors.
- Remove the old doors: Remove the bifold doors and hardware, making sure to prevent damaging the surrounding frame.
- Check and repair the frame: Inspect the frame for any damage or wear and tear. Make any essential repairs before proceeding.
- Install the new track: Install the brand-new track or hardware for the replacement doors, following the producer's directions.
- Hang the brand-new doors: Hang the brand-new doors, ensuring they're level and firmly connected to the frame.
- Add any complements: Add any finishing touches, such as decorative hardware or trim, to finish the installation.
